I'm posting here for more eyes, but if this is better suited in the Mods/Acc forum...then pls move.

Two months ago I traded in a 2013 Ram 1500 Sport for a 2023 Rebel Night Edition Hemi 4x4. The truck is loaded with all the Tech & Safety pkgs, UC5 as well as Tow pkg. I don't tow frequently and when I do it's smaller trailers ..nothing the size of large TTs so what I've got is a bit of overkill. The passenger Tow mirror I HATE! Mirrors have all the options: Pwr folding, Pwr adj, heat, blind spot, puddle lights, as well as 360 cameras.

Has anyone with new 5th Gen swapped successfully tow mirrors for sport mirrors with all the options? Reading all the old threads, seems it might be a pain or not possible (especially camera calibration). Again, these were old threads so not sure of its similar to newer models. I will be going to talk to dealer but wanted to start here to see if this is even possible.

Hi, I was wondering if you ever did the swap. I have a 21 limited with the tow mirrors and want to swap to reg/sport mirrors as well. Been combing the site for info.. Sounds like it will work but mainly I need the part numbers. Would you happen to have them? Thanks!
Any sport style mirrors from a 5th gen 1500 will fit your truck. Just make sure you find a set with the same features your current mirrors has if you want to retain them.
